Output 9bd1db9f85627aa67a03efcedba5aaf3f2a679ea2e46065d74b53d59c6f1e88b:5

value
621010313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bad99628c24e2e3e66df9c0c8bb2bdf14eb2594 OP_EQUAL
address
378Zkk3B2KsaopSDBqqinjg78SkqoJ7UfR
transaction
9bd1db9f85627aa67a03efcedba5aaf3f2a679ea2e46065d74b53d59c6f1e88b
confirmations
315868
spent
true